【ndk安装配置】在Android开发中,NDK(Native Development Kit)是一个非常重要的工具,它允许开发者使用C/C++语言编写高性能的代码,并与Java/Kotlin进行交互。正确安装和配置NDK是进行原生开发的基础步骤。以下是对NDK安装与配置的总结。
一、NDK安装配置概述
NDK的安装和配置主要包括以下几个步骤:
1. 下载NDK版本
2. 解压并设置环境变量
3. 在Android Studio中配置NDK路径
4. 验证NDK是否成功安装
整个过程相对简单,但需要关注版本兼容性及系统环境设置。
二、NDK安装配置步骤总结
步骤 | 操作内容 | 说明 |
1 | 下载NDK | 从[官方下载页面](https://developer.android.com/ndk/downloads)选择合适的版本,支持Windows、Mac、Linux系统 |
2 | 解压NDK文件 | 将下载的压缩包解压到指定目录,如 `C:\Users\YourName\AppData\Local\Android\Sdk\ndk\` |
3 | 设置环境变量 | 在系统环境变量中添加 `ANDROID_NDK_HOME`,指向NDK的安装路径 |
4 | 配置Android Studio | 打开Android Studio,进入 `File > Project Structure > SDK Location`,设置NDK路径 |
5 | 验证安装 | 在终端运行 `ndk-build --version` 或查看Android Studio中的NDK版本信息 |
三、常见问题与解决方法
问题 | 解决方案 |
NDK未被识别 | 确保环境变量已正确设置,重启IDE后再次检查 |
版本不兼容 | 使用与当前Android Studio版本匹配的NDK版本 |
编译失败 | 检查CMakeLists.txt或Android.mk配置是否正确 |
路径错误 | 确认NDK安装路径无中文或空格,建议使用英文路径 |
四、NDK版本推荐
Android Studio版本 | 推荐NDK版本 |
Android Studio 2023.1.x | NDK 26.x |
Android Studio 2022.1.x | NDK 25.x |
Android Studio 2021.1.x | NDK 23.x |
五、小结
NDK的安装与配置虽然步骤不多,但对开发者的原生代码编译和调试至关重要。合理选择NDK版本、正确设置环境变量、并在Android Studio中准确配置路径,可以有效避免后续开发中的各种问题。建议在项目初期就完成NDK的安装与测试,确保开发流程顺畅。
通过以上内容,您可以快速完成NDK的安装与配置,为后续的原生开发打下坚实基础。